xAI completes training run for Grok V9 model
xAI completed an internal training run for its Grok V9 foundation model with 1.5 trillion parameters. The model is three times larger than the 0.5 trillion parameter base used in the current Grok 4.2 release. Initial results are strong ahead of supplemental training that will incorporate data from Cursor. Internal versioning marks Grok V9 as a distinct step from version 8 with major differences in scale and training approach.

The version numbers are a little confusing and deserve some explanation.
Internally, we are working on version 9 of our new foundation model, which is 1.5T params. This is substantially better in every way than v8: data curation, training recipe, size, etc. It is also optimized to run on a Blackwells.
The public facing v4.2 is based on foundation model v8, trained on Hoppers, with significant shortfalls in training data quality, comprehensiveness and proportionality. It is also only 0.5T in size.
The difference between Grok foundation model 8 and 9 is gigantic.
